Description

n-(Dimethylamino-Methylamino-Phosphoryl)Methanamine is a specialized organophosphorus compound featuring a unique phosphoryl-linked diamine structure. This molecular architecture makes it a valuable intermediate for synthesizing complex ligands, catalysts, and functional materials. It is primarily sought by R&D chemists and process development scientists in the pharmaceutical, agrochemical, and advanced materials sectors for constructing novel molecular frameworks.

Basic Information

Product Name n-(Dimethylamino-Methylamino-Phosphoryl)Methanamine
CAS No. 16853-36-4
Molecular Formula C5H14N3OP
Molecular Weight 163.16 g/mol
Synonyms N,N-Dimethyl-P,P-bis(methylamino)phosphinous amide; Phosphoramide, N,N-dimethyl-N',N'-bis(methylamino)-; N-(Dimethylamino)-N',N'-bis(methylamino)phosphoramide; 1,1'-(Dimethylphosphorylidene)bis(N-methylmethanamine); Bis(methylamino)(dimethylamino)phosphine oxide; DMAMP

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at a controlled room temperature (typically 15-25°C). This material is hygroscopic (moisture-sensitive) and should be handled under an inert atmosphere to maintain stability and purity.
